Mykola Katerynchuk will submit a cassation complaint in the case of Oksana Makar

30/05/2013 17:14

Mykolaiv Court of Appeal refused to change the sentence for the murder and the rapist of Oksana Makar.

The Court in one session reviewed the appeals of the condemned and the appeal of Mykola Katerynchuk, in which he asked to sentence the life imprisonment for Maxim Prisyazhnyuk and Artem Pogosyan.

Appealing convicted Evheniy Krasnoshchok accused Prisyazhnyuk of killing Oksana Makar and denied the fact of rape, arguing that intimacy was affected by mutual consent.

Commenting on the decision a representative of the injured party, People’s Deputy of Ukraine Mykola Katerynchuk said: “We are not satisfied with the taken decision and after the announcement of its reasoning part we will submit a cassation complaint. It is expected that this (announcement of the decision) will take place on June 6, “- he said.
